Projex Advising on Over 800 New Build Hotel Beds

Monday 9th April 2018

Send to colleague

Projex has been appointed to advise on the construction of over 800 new hotel beds in the past six months.

The appointments come on the back of the consultancy’s extensive experience in the leisure sector, having delivered a number of major successful mixed-use developments for leading UK companies such as LxB, Landsec and Hammerson.

Projex is appointed on two hotel projects for Paradigm Asset Management, which involve the redevelopment of former regional newspaper offices in Liverpool and Newcastle held by Trinity Mirror Group.

The redevelopment of the Liverpool Echo and printing works site has been designed by architects Corstorphine + Wright to take advantage of the building’s stunning views across the Mersey and city and include a 207-bed hotel with ‘sky bar’ on the top of the tower. 

Plans were submitted to Liverpool Council in January and the project will also include offices, car parking as well as retail units and a gym at street level.

If approved, work would start on site in May with an initial strip out and asbestos removal contract, with main development works commencing late September 2018 for a period of twelve months.  Projex is providing full consultancy including PM/EA/QS and principal designer roles.

Elsewhere, Projex is advising on a new 421-bed project opposite the Westfield Shopping Centre, Stratford, comprising a 285-bed Hilton Curio and 136-bedroom Adagio aparthotel.

The company is also appointed on a new Premier Inn in Hertford for Wrenbridge and a 72-bed Premier Inn for Roubaix AM at Fareham and recently advised on a new multi-million pound spa development at Swinton Park, a luxury castle hotel in the heart of the Yorkshire Dales and one of the largest privately-owned family estates in the country. Projex was the appointed client representative for the Swinton Park project.
